// lib/editor/canvas/note_background.dart // // rnote-style page background TEMPLATES for the blank-note editor. A background // is a repeating PATTERN painted in the note page's local pixel space (the // `pageWidget` is sized to the page rect inside the InteractiveViewer, so a // CustomPainter here scales 1:1 with zoom — no extra transform needed). // // The choice is per-notebook and persists in the sidecar (stored as the enum // `name`; missing/unknown → [NoteBackground.blank] for back-compat). import 'package:flutter/material.dart'; /// The available page-background templates (rnote: blank + dots/lines/grid + /// the Cornell note layout). enum NoteBackground { /// Plain white sheet, no pattern. blank, /// A regular grid of small dots (dotted paper). dots, /// Evenly spaced horizontal lines (ruled / lined paper). ruled, /// Square grid (graph paper). grid, /// Cornell layout: a left cue-column line + a bottom summary line over a /// ruled note-taking body. cornell, } /// Decode a persisted background name (the enum [NoteBackground.name]); unknown /// or missing values fall back to [NoteBackground.blank] (back-compat). NoteBackground noteBackgroundFromName(String? name) { for (final b in NoteBackground.values) { if (b.name == name) return b; } return NoteBackground.blank; } /// Localized-ish English display label for the picker menu. String noteBackgroundLabel(NoteBackground b) { switch (b) { case NoteBackground.blank: return 'Blank'; case NoteBackground.dots: return 'Dots'; case NoteBackground.ruled: return 'Ruled lines'; case NoteBackground.grid: return 'Grid'; case NoteBackground.cornell: return 'Cornell'; } } /// An icon for the picker menu. IconData noteBackgroundIcon(NoteBackground b) { switch (b) { case NoteBackground.blank: return Icons.crop_portrait; case NoteBackground.dots: return Icons.grain; case NoteBackground.ruled: return Icons.notes; case NoteBackground.grid: return Icons.grid_4x4; case NoteBackground.cornell: return Icons.view_quilt_outlined; } } /// Paints a [NoteBackground] template behind the ink, in the page's local pixel /// space. Spacing is page-relative (a fraction of page width) so the template /// looks the same on any logical page size, and the lines are a light, subtle /// grey so they sit behind handwriting. class NoteBackgroundPainter extends CustomPainter { const NoteBackgroundPainter(this.background); final NoteBackground background; /// Pattern spacing as a fraction of the page WIDTH — a ~28-line page. static const double _spacingFraction = 1 / 28; static const Color _lineColor = Color(0x1A000000); // ~10% black, subtle grey. static const Color _dotColor = Color(0x33000000); // dots a touch darker. static const Color _accentColor = Color(0x33335C81); // Cornell margin lines. @override void paint(Canvas canvas, Size size) { if (background == NoteBackground.blank) return; final spacing = size.width * _spacingFraction; if (spacing <= 0) return; switch (background) { case NoteBackground.blank: break; case NoteBackground.dots: _paintDots(canvas, size, spacing); case NoteBackground.ruled: _paintRuled(canvas, size, spacing); case NoteBackground.grid: _paintGrid(canvas, size, spacing); case NoteBackground.cornell: _paintCornell(canvas, size, spacing); } } void _paintDots(Canvas canvas, Size size, double spacing) { final paint = Paint() ..color = _dotColor ..style = PaintingStyle.fill; final r = (spacing * 0.06).clamp(0.6, 2.0); for (double y = spacing; y < size.height; y += spacing) { for (double x = spacing; x < size.width; x += spacing) { canvas.drawCircle(Offset(x, y), r, paint); } } } void _paintRuled(Canvas canvas, Size size, double spacing) { final paint = Paint() ..color = _lineColor ..strokeWidth = 1.0; for (double y = spacing; y < size.height; y += spacing) { canvas.drawLine(Offset(0, y), Offset(size.width, y), paint); } } void _paintGrid(Canvas canvas, Size size, double spacing) { final paint = Paint() ..color = _lineColor ..strokeWidth = 1.0; for (double y = spacing; y < size.height; y += spacing) { canvas.drawLine(Offset(0, y), Offset(size.width, y), paint); } for (double x = spacing; x < size.width; x += spacing) { canvas.drawLine(Offset(x, 0), Offset(x, size.height), paint); } } void _paintCornell(Canvas canvas, Size size, double spacing) { // Ruled body lines. _paintRuled(canvas, size, spacing); final accent = Paint() ..color = _accentColor ..strokeWidth = 1.4; // Left cue-column vertical line (~25% of width). final cueX = size.width * 0.25; // Bottom summary horizontal line (~80% down). final summaryY = size.height * 0.80; canvas.drawLine(Offset(cueX, 0), Offset(cueX, summaryY), accent); canvas.drawLine(Offset(0, summaryY), Offset(size.width, summaryY), accent); } @override bool shouldRepaint(covariant NoteBackgroundPainter oldDelegate) => oldDelegate.background != background; }
